Program Plan
|
|
|
- Phase I: 10-20 year simulations using NCEP boundary
conditions (led by Iowa
State/PIRCS) —
provision of boundary conditions, data storage, initial
RCM performance evaluation with major participation of
each RCM group). Some
preliminary results from analysis of NCEP-driven runs
(PPT file).
- Phase IIa: RCM runs (50 km resolution.) nested in
AOGCMs (SRES A2 scenario 2041-2070) — output storage
managed by LLNL with strong participation of PIRCS at Iowa
State.
- Phase IIb: Time-slice experiments — for
comparison with RCM runs (GFDL and LLNL running NCAR
CAM3). In the time-slice experiments, the atmospheric
portion of an AOGCM is run at 50-km resolution with
seasonally-varying observed SST (sea-surface
temperatures). For the future run, ΔSST from the
coupled experiment is added to the observed SST to
generate future SST boundary conditions. The timeslice
experiments are global in extent, though global data may
not be available.
- Opportunity for double nesting (over specific regions)
to draw in other RCM groups (e.g., NOAA OGP RISAs).
